Job summary

Prospero Teaching is seeking a committed SEMH Teaching Assistant to join a specialist secondary SEMH school in Blackburn from September. The role involves supporting pupils aged 11-16 with SEMH, ADHD, Autism and behavioural challenges, providing 1:1 mentoring and small-group interventions.

You'll work with teachers and pastoral staff to promote emotional regulation and positive engagement with education, requiring resilience, patience and strong communication.

Qualifications

  • Experience in SEN, care, youth work, mentoring or similar desirable.
  • Resilient, patient, and emotionally intelligent.
  • Strong communication and behaviour management skills.

Responsibilities

  • Provide 1:1 mentoring and classroom support for pupils aged 11–16.
  • Deliver small-group interventions to aid learning and engagement.
  • Support emotional regulation and positive engagement with education.
